#de0205 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de0205 is composed of 87.1% red, 0.8%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.9%. #de0205 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ff040a with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#de0205 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de0205 has RGB values of R:222, G:2,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.98,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14549509.

Shades and Tints of #de0205
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080000 is the darkest color, while #fff4f4 is the lightest one.
